来源:CSDN(ID:CSDNnews)

对于技术人而言,似乎有永远退不了的休,但这种情况多数都是他们的主动选择,且乐在其中。

63 岁退休工程师的研发之路

近日,据外媒 The Mainichi 报道,一位来自日本的 63 岁老工程师  Hiroyuki Ueda 在退休之后,捣鼓起了计算机上的计算器。

或许有人说,像手机、电脑上的计算器早已出现,再去重复研究,那岂不是再一波造轮子,有什么意义?

实则与我们常见的计算器有所不同,Hiroyuki Ueda 研发的这款名为 Twin-Calc 的计算器应用,是一款将两个计算器二合一的产品,简单来看,就是可以在同一个界面显示两个计算器。

当然,同一个界面显示两个计算器也自然有它的道理,这款双计算器应用程序允许用户点击屏幕中间的“左右绿色箭头”直接将一边的输出结果导入到另一边去。

举个例子,如果你在左边的计算器上输入“89*15”,点击“=”之后得到 1335 的结果,然后再点击向右的绿色箭头,那么 1335 就可以直接显示在右边的计算器上,如下图所示:

除此之外,两个计算器也可以执行不同的计算。譬如,当用户想要了解哪个商店的产品价格比较便宜时,就可以用同时计算的方式来比较价格,也挺方便的。

挑战无数,只怕“有心”

之所以想要开发这款双计算器应用,在 Hiroyuki Ueda 看来,这也是退休之后,有更多的时间来实现自己积攒多年的兴趣。

事实上,Hiroyuki Ueda 并非计算机专业出身,他在大学主要学的是机械设计,后来在一家汽车公司从事工程工作,包括传动部件的设计,这一干就是多年。

但对于自身而言,Hiroyuki Ueda 是一名狂热的 iPhone 粉丝,因此在 60 岁退休之后,他便着手自己的“开发大计”。

他首先自学了 Swift 编程语言,然后关注到了与人们日常生活紧密相连且作为一种没有任何语言障碍的通用工具——计算器,Hiroyuki Ueda 随即便开始为开发一款应用程序定制目标,进行规划。

在 2021 年 8 月,Hiroyuki Ueda 开始真正开发这款 Twin-Calc 应用。彼时,Hiroyuki Ueda 表示,“在一个屏幕上结合两个计算器的应用程序此时还不存在,抓住这个机会,一定要做一个独一无二的软件”,他的目标是让该应用程序成功在 iPhone、iPad 上运行。

然而,Hiroyuki Ueda 回忆道:"我以为这很容易,但却出乎意料的困难"。譬如,在输入带有小数点的数字时,虽然有用户通常是点击“0-小数点-具体数字”(如 0.5),但也有不少用户是直接输入了“小数点-具体数字”,而省略了输入“0”这一步。

Hiroyuki Ueda 表示:"这类的挑战大约有 100 种,要解决这些问题是一个很大的工作。"经过不断的试验和测试,他得以在 9 个月后的 2022 年 5 月发布该应用程序。

不过,Twin-Calc 一经发布,并没有迎来 Hiroyuki Ueda 想象中的火爆。

在排查其中的原因时,Hiroyuki Ueda 发现,当用户下载应用程序并打开时,在智能手机的垂直屏幕模式下,手机屏幕只显示一个计算器,而在屏幕旋转到侧面时才显示两个计算器。但这样,很多用户觉得这款应用和系统自带的计算器没有太大差别,没有必要再去下载一个。

于是,Hiroyuki Ueda 进行了修改,使得这款应用可以固定水平显示两个计算器,这一最新版本于 8 月 18 日发布。目前 Twin-Calc 分为两种版本:免费版和付费版,其中免费版里面会有广告,已经在 iPhone 和 iPad 上可用。

受到了良好的欢迎

更新之后的 Twin-Calc 也受到了很多用户的欢迎,截至 9 月 8 日,含税 490 日元(约 3 美元)的付费版 Twin-Calc 版本有约 56,800 次下载,免费版本有约 5,000 次下载。付费版本在更新前不久有大约 1.8 万次下载,因此在更新后数量增加了两倍多。

对此,不少网友表示:

  • 有人在手机上添加这个真的很酷。我喜欢听到开发者开发的东西填补了一个利基市场,而且做得如此之好,非常钦佩。

  • 改进一个计算器应用程序的设计是非常困难的,而且它正在不断地被改进。对大多数人来说,这是很好的。也祝贺他,他正在实现梦想,构建能够完成工作的软件,然后为该软件获得报酬。我只希望他在接下来不要遭受太多山寨软件的“袭击”。

除此之外,也有不少用户为其下一步的开发方向提供优化建议,甚至出谋划策:

  • 这款软件非常有趣,但是下面重复的几组数字按钮是对空间极大的浪费。也希望接下来,开发者可以避免重复,直接通过输入行输入,就像电子表格中的一个单列一样。

  • 或许也可以尝试开发做一个小屏幕的电子表格,像一个默认的 3x4 或 4x4 单元格。其中可以包常规电子表格的大部分基础功能,也许还有简单的图表来显示比较。

对于外界的评价,Hiroyuki Ueda 表示:"令人惊讶的是,有大量的人下载了这个应用程序。我认为它有市场需求。”

退不了休的技术大佬们

只要满足了需求,必然也会有人用,Hiroyuki Ueda 也在退休的时光中实现了自己的梦想。

无独有偶,不少大佬退休之后坚守在技术的中心。两年前,求伯君在参加 2020 长沙·中国 1024 程序员节时分享道,“退休是真的,我没有再去参与公司的日常管理。因为身体不好,我正在锻炼身体,平时会关注一些感兴趣的东西,也写一些自己用的游戏代码,不是作为商品去写的,譬如游戏外挂之类的,当然不方便拿出来炫耀。为了完成游戏的任务,写代码将自己从劳动中解放出来。”

此外,80 岁的 UNIX 核心开发者之一、UNIX 命名者 Brian W.Kernighan,在今年夏季闪现文本处理工具、Linux 及 UNIX 环境中最强大的数据处理引擎 AWK 在 GitHub 的仓库上(https://github.com/onetrueawk/awk),潇洒地写了数百行代码,提交了最新的 pull request,留言告诉开发者这些代码可以让 AWK 实现 Unicode 的支持。

2020 年 11 月,64 岁的 Python 之父 Guido van Rossum 在宣布自己退休的一年后,决定重返职场,原因是退休太无聊了,加盟微软,在拥抱开源平台之际,致力于“让 Python 变得更好用”。

同时,还有很多像他们一样的技术人也在默默奉献,也在无形之中激励了更多的开发者们。谨此也向他们致敬!

参考资料:

https://mainichi.jp/english/articles/20220916/p2a/00m/0sc/017000c

https://news.ycombinator.com/item?id=32902520

------

我们创建了一个高质量的技术交流群,与优秀的人在一起,自己也会优秀起来,赶紧点击加群,享受一起成长的快乐。另外,如果你最近想跳槽的话,年前我花了2周时间收集了一波大厂面经,节后准备跳槽的可以点击这里领取!

推荐阅读

  • 《羊了个羊》创始人被母校制成展牌...

  • 程序员离职后躲老家山洞 2 年,敲出 45 万行代码...

  • 接手了一座“屎山”,我到底该重写还是跳槽?

··································

你好,我是程序猿DD,10年开发老司机、阿里云MVP、腾讯云TVP、出过书创过业、国企4年互联网6年。从普通开发到架构师、再到合伙人。一路过来,给我最深的感受就是一定要不断学习并关注前沿。只要你能坚持下来,多思考、少抱怨、勤动手,就很容易实现弯道超车!所以,不要问我现在干什么是否来得及。如果你看好一个事情,一定是坚持了才能看到希望,而不是看到希望才去坚持。相信我,只要坚持下来,你一定比现在更好!如果你还没什么方向,可以先关注我,这里会经常分享一些前沿资讯,帮你积累弯道超车的资本。

点击领取2022最新10000T学习资料

63 岁工程师的退休生活:开发一款计算器应用,22 天获 56800 下载!相关推荐

  1. 63岁工程师的退休生活:开发一款双计算器应用,仅上线22天获56800次下载量!

    整理 | 苏宓 出品 | CSDN(ID:CSDNnews) 对于技术人而言,似乎有永远退不了的休,但这种情况多数都是他们的主动选择,且乐在其中. 63 岁退休工程师的研发之路 近日,据外媒 The ...

  2. 63岁工程师的退休生活:开发一款双计算器应用,仅上线22天获56800次下载量!...

    点击上方"AI遇见机器学习",选择"星标"公众号 重磅干货,第一时间送 整理 | 苏宓 出品 | CSDN(ID:CSDNnews) 对于技术人而言,似乎有永远 ...

  3. 厉害,63岁程序员,退休之后开发一款神奇应用,仅上线22天获56800次下载量!...

    ‍ ‍整理 | 苏宓 出品 | CSDN(ID:CSDNnews) 对于技术人而言,似乎有永远退不了的休,但这种情况多数都是他们的主动选择,且乐在其中. 01 63 岁退休工程师的研发之路 近日,据外 ...

  4. 和12岁小同志搞创客开发:手撕代码,Arduino IDE 软件下载和环境搭建

    目录 1.软件下载 2. 软件安装 3.环境搭建和使用 机缘巧合在网上认识一位12岁小同志,从零开始系统辅导其创客开发思维和技巧. 项目专栏:https://blog.csdn.net/m0_3810 ...

  5. 中国退休养老调查:80后为父母养老不嫌贵,90后00后对退休生活预期信心不足...

    美世中国.大家保险集团.同方全球人寿等多家机构和研究协会发布研究报告,对中国养老市场的需求和未来趋势做出分析洞察. 80后为父母养老不嫌贵,并且更早考虑自己的养老问题 中国老年学和老年医学学会老龄金融 ...

  6. 你还在发愁35岁以后吗?国外63岁的工程师却开发一个爆款计算器

    整理 | 苏宓 出品 | CSDN(ID:CSDNnews) 对于技术人而言,似乎有永远退不了的休,但这种情况多数都是他们的主动选择,且乐在其中. 63 岁退休工程师的研发之路 近日,据外媒 The ...

  7. 64岁Python之父:退休生活太无聊,我要加入微软,将开源进行到底

    2020-11-13 15:50:45 今日凌晨,64岁的 Python 语言的创建者 Guido van Rossum 发推表示,退休生活太无聊,决定入职微软. 吉多·范罗苏姆(Guido van ...

  8. 63 岁老工程师设计一屏双计算器软件工具,一起看看?

    近日,据外媒 The Mainichi 报道,一位来自日本的 63 岁老工程师 Hiroyuki Ueda 在退休之后,捣鼓起了计算机上的计算器.或许有人说,像手机.电脑上的计算器早已出现,再去重复研 ...

  9. 39岁单身程序员入住养老院,提前过上退休生活?网友:羡慕又心酸!

    坊间传言程序员35岁就到退休年龄,如今竟然有一个39岁的程序员直接住进了养老院!这是怎么一回事? 近日,重庆一家养老院迎来了全市最年轻的住户--39岁的程序员古先生,全院的平均入住年龄顿时被拉低了不少 ...

  10. 自学编程,28岁从字节退休,期权过亿法拉利,日本开温泉酒店

    本文转载自公众号:新智元   新智元报道   来源:知乎 编辑:梦佳.永上 [新智元导读]最近28岁程序员郭宇宣布退休上了知乎热搜.郭宇是谁?高考后自学编程,非计算机专业出身,曾入职支付宝,2014年 ...

最新文章

  1. PNAS-2018-根系分泌物香豆素调控微生物群落结构并促进植物健康
  2. Leaflet绘制热力图【转】
  3. springboot源码分析之环境属性构造过程1
  4. mybatis使用truncate清除表数据
  5. 基于Spring Security的认证授权_方法授权_Spring Security OAuth2.0认证授权---springcloud工作笔记133
  6. 美团多渠道打包原理以及使用
  7. SQL Server 2008 安装或卸载时提示“重启计算机失败的解决办法(转)
  8. vi编辑器的常用命令
  9. Java面试----2018年最新Struts2面试题
  10. 2018 Google IO大会来了
  11. Linux下文件、文件夹大小排序及文件内容排序
  12. 蓝桥杯2018国赛B组第四题 调手表
  13. html中的图片路径ie8,IE8下文件上传时获取文件的真实路径
  14. linux 做路由器系统下载文件,用Linux系统做路由器
  15. html网页组织结构,使用HTML和CSS编码创建组织结构图
  16. 鲁大师5月新机性能榜:红魔6R夺冠,“特供版”新机密集
  17. python的self.boardx -= 5 什么意思_python小白求帮助
  18. 一位测试员的自白:漫漫测试路,我们因隐秘而伟大
  19. unity 扎金花比大小
  20. 《我们与恶的距离》引发媒体反思:假新闻抢热点,机器学习能做些什么?

热门文章

  1. java我的世界光影推荐_最棒的7款我的世界光影水反效果包
  2. 易经入门(体系最完整,推荐书目最完备,易经周易入门必收藏)
  3. 标签打印软件如何批量打印可变内容
  4. MSDN for VB6.0 正常安装后仍然不能显示帮助的处理
  5. k2路由器刷华硕固件
  6. matlab步长教程,matlab仿真步长
  7. Cplex安装教程与使用介绍
  8. 2021年全国大学生电子设计大赛题目
  9. Android Effect 解析
  10. Java网络编程总结